Jquery events list These events are often triggered by the end user's interaction with the page, such as when text is entered into a form element or the mouse pointer is moved. Feb 19, 2011 · If you want to do something special on a day hover you could attach a . Understanding how events propagate is an important factor in being able to leverage Event Delegation. For example, consider the HTML: link jQuery Event Basics link Setting Up Event Responses on DOM Elements. 7, the on() method is the new replacement for the bind(), live() and delegate() methods. 0. click Jul 7, 2023 · Events and Syntax of jQuery. It can also be used as a single date picker besides the range selection feature. Apr 23, 2024 · (Events fired in code by . click() It is used to trigger the click event for 1 min read . It is recommended to watch event. Event object with the needed values and trigger using that object. 7+. Apr 27, 2012 · jQuery change event occurs when the value of an element is changed. An Bind an event handler to be fired when the element loses keyboard focus, or trigger that event on an element. focusin() Sep 19, 2018 · Caleran is a Date Range Picker plugin, built using jQuery and moment. ajaxSuccess), . Can be shown inline or used as a dropdown beside an input. event. com. $("#ddrp1"). how can i set the value (which is taken fr i need list events (birthday parties, events ) in Jquery UI Datepicker, When I click on these events, I'd like to change the hover for example in the calendar. jQuery makes it straightforward to set up event-driven responses on page elements. Here are the following events of jQuery with syntax given below. Click Apr 23, 2024 · jQuery provides a method . data(elem, 'events') and if you are using jQuery 1. 3. List of jQuery Events Shortcut functions. ajaxSend(), . Handle Events; Angular. I bound an event on the change event of my select elements with this: $('select'). find(':selected'). Mar 7, 2013 · I need to be able to dynamically create <select> element and turn it into jQuery . This should be element creation event, as opposed to some "click" event in which case I could just use jQuery . Event Type & Description. push( "newPropertyName" ). javascript $("#itemList"). I guess, when will click on next-previous-button then I'll send current date('y-m-d') to url: 'fetch-events. k. Following is the syntax of the jQuery event on() method − $(selector). charCode on the MDN. 102, 2008 ed. change() Bind an event handler to be fired when the element's value changes, or trigger that event on an element. For most events, whenever something occurs on a page (like an element is clicked), the event travels from the element it occurred on, up to its parent, then up to the parent's parent, and so on, until it reaches the root element, a. To bind to an event of a UI widget, you can use basic jQuery syntax. The indented events are triggered for each and every Ajax request (unless a global option has been set). I fixed that flaw and you can find the code below. The mouse button is released while the pointer is inside the element. For more detail, read about event. Event Handling Jun 15, 2009 · I want to trigger the change event of dropdown in $(document). ready using jquery. Bind an event handler to the “change” event, or trigger that event on an element. This event is limited to input elements, textarea boxes and select elements. on("click", "li", function() { // Code to handle the click event for list items }); 4. Attach a handler to one or more events for all elements that match the selector, now or in the future, based on a specific set of root elements. ajaxStart(), . live handler (or delegate), live is needed since the datepicker is created after the dom has finished loading, to the day element and do some sort of lookup if you need to display a tooltip, box, or something else unique on the dom. props. In this case, since our new anchor did not exist when . ) To add a property name to this list, use jQuery. 1. It is true that, on p. jQuery provides methods to attach event handlers to elements, such as clicks, keypresses, and form submissions. The event object provides various useful information about the event. jQuery normalizes the following properties for cross-browser consistency: target; relatedTarget; pageX; pageY; which; metaKey; The following properties are also copied to the event object, though some of their values may be undefined depending on the event: In modern versions of jQuery, you would use the $. event. The following table lists all the jQuery methods used to handle events. on('change', '', function (e) { }); How can I access the element which got selected when the change event occurs? jQuery Reference - Events - Explore the comprehensive jQuery reference for handling events, including methods, properties, and examples to enhance your web applications. The event handling There's no official API for doing this. find('option'); above Jul 25, 2024 · For a comprehensive list of Selectors, please refer to the jQuery Selectors Complete Reference article. These Evemts are - . Event methods trigger or attach a function to an event handler for the selected elements. Examples: The term "fires/fired" is often used with events. Thus I was led to here and astounded to learn that 'input' is an acceptable parameter to jquery's bind() command. on() method is called. Explore click, hover, focus, form, and advanced events with examples Events/API/jQuery Page Load ready(fn) DOMがロードされて操作・解析が可能になったタイミングで関数を実行します。 Event Handling The click event is only triggered after this exact series of events: The mouse button is depressed while the pointer is inside the element. This event could be used to show a message to the user stating that a row has been created, edited or removed. Although . 1. Syntax: $(selector). Blur Occurs when the element loses focus. May 27, 2024 · jQuery UI consists of GUI widgets, visual effects, and themes implemented using HTML, CSS, and jQuery. Event Handling; Vue. The jQuery change () is an inbuilt method that is used to detect the change in the value of input fields. Bind an event handler to multiple elements jQuery? 0. mozilla. It will take of everything based on the browser jQuery provides a cross-browser event modal it is simple to use with compact and simplified syntax. This event is limited to <input> elements, <textarea> boxes and <select> elements. 8 or later you will no longer be able to use the function above! In exchange for jQuery. Most jQuery methods correspond to native DOM events. In jQuery in Action (p. ajaxStart (Global Event) Feb 13, 2024 · jQuery Event Modal will simplify it by wrapping up both the functionality. The following table lists all jQuery methods and corresponding DOM events. click() For jQuery 1. focus() Bind an event handler to be fired when the element gains keyboard focus, or trigger that event on an element May 1, 2011 · var events = $. 3 | Events > Form Events . It is generally used together with other events of jQuery. Use on() method to bind event handlers. Note, this is an internal-use only method: Bind an event handler to the “click” event, or trigger that event on an element. Click() This event occurs whenever the element is clicked. jquery. Home Whiteboard AI Assistant Online Compilers Jobs Tools Articles Corporate Training Practice Oct 10, 2012 · It installs a generic jQuery event handler on the #myParent object. As of jQuery version 1. isDefaultPrevented() The jQuery on() method was introduced in jQuery version 1. This object can be used to determine the nature of the event, and to prevent the event’s default behavior. You can check out the full list of jQuery events: http://api. Event Jul 22, 2010 · JQuery List Events. js libraries. which for keyboard key input. In addition to the built-in events, jQuery allows you to create custom events. This is usually the desired sequence before taking an action. jQuery Whenever a jQuery event is fired, jQuery passes an Event Object to every event handler function. 92, the The select event is sent to an element when the user makes a text selection inside it. Optionally, it can also receive event-related data as its second argument, pushing the event handling function to the third argument. Use event. The event handling function can receive an event object. The example below shows how the draw event can be listened for: The event. The jqxListBox represents a jQuery listbox widget that contains a list of selectable items. I have a cascading dropdown for country and state in user details page. jQuery. special, but the accepted answer may still be The change event is sent to an element when its value changes. This event is limited to <input type="text"> fields and <textarea> boxes. Read More - jQuery Interview Questions for Freshers Handling Events. The jQuery UI menu select event is used trig Just as silkfire commented it, I too googled for 'jQuery input event'. Apr 23, 2024 · Event delegation works because of the notion of event bubbling. keyCode and event. JavaScript/jQuery List Events This section describes events fired by this UI component. However, I just realized you want all the native jQuery events - you could inspect $. The on() method attaches one or more event handlers for the selected elements and child elements. Learning jQuery Fourth Edition Karl Swedberg and Jonathan Chaffer; Apr 23, 2024 · For details on jQuery events, visit the Events documentation on api. NO. Advanced Event Concepts 4. ajaxComplete May 14, 2014 · This is actually not optimized if the datalist nor options ever change, since every keystroke re-initializes the $('datalist)` jQuery object and then instantiates a new array with all the options in this data list, better would be to cache the options "outside" the event handler e. Syntax. A good list is provided by MDN https://developer. The ajaxStart and ajaxStop events are events that relate to all Ajax requests together. Apr 23, 2024 · . The . Deprecated in jQuery 1. 7. It is great for building UI interfaces for the webpages. combobox(). Change Occurs when the element changes. jQuery is tailor-made to respond to events in an HTML page. Any data that is passed will be available to the event handling function in the data property of the event object. on(events, [selector], [data], handler) Learn how to handle user interactions using jQuery events. 2 and lower, jQuery no longer stores the event object in jQuery. _data method to find any events attached by jQuery to the element in question. These events can be triggered manually and provide a way to define your own interactions and behaviors. To learn more, read more about the evolution of event binding in jQuery. However, be aware that every event processed by jQuery will now attempt to copy this property The events DataTables emits can all be listened for using the on() method, or the jQuery. This click() method triggers the clicked element, also known as the click event, which attaches to a function whenever a click-related event occurs. It attaches a single event handler for those two events, and the handler must examine event. Apr 18, 2025 · The complete list of jQuery Events is given below: Methods: This is used to attach one or more event handlers for selected elements. For details on the event object, visit the Event object documentation on api. jQuery Events. An event represents the precise moment when something happens. 9: The name "hover" used as a shorthand for the string "mouseenter mouseleave". If this is not required, the mousedown or mouseup event may be more suitable. The jQuery library provides methods to handle DOM events. text(); alert (getText); // show the text value of the selected element Bind an event handler to the “focusin” event, or trigger that event on an element. Events > Event Object. on() was called, it does not get the event handler. When a click event bubbles up to this delegated event handler, jQuery has to go through the list of delegated event handlers attached to this object and see if the originating element for the event matches any of the selectors in the delegated event handlers. Also in: Deprecated > Deprecated 3. on() isn't the only method provided for event binding, it is a best practice to use this for jQuery 1. charCode. 2. Syntax $(selector). Common Event Properties. Definition and Usage. _data(elem, 'events'). jQuery Events involve handling user interactions and other occurrences on a web page. Jun 22, 2016 · I need to find all events handlers attached to #mySelect and if the event is created via jQuery I can get it , here alert(e) will show only "change" without "click" JavaScript : $("#mySelect"). have const myOptions = $('datalist'). g. jQuery in Action Bear Bibeault, Yehuda Katz, and Aurelio De Rosa; Aug 29, 2024 · When you click on an element, the click event occurs and once the click event occurs it execute the click method or attaches a function to run. change (function () { var getText = $(this). on(), and pass the a selector combined with 'myclass' as an argument. 7, and its providing an appropriate way to handle events that replaced older methods such as bind(), live(), and delegate(). jQuery Mouse events handle interactions with the mouse, like click, hover, dblclick. The Editor event interface is built upon, and styled after, the jQuery DOM event interface. ) 'input' is not mentionned as a possible event (against 20 others, from 'blur' to 'unload'). on() method takes an event type and an event handling function as arguments. on(). Jul 7, 2023 · Guide to jQuery Events. The element where the currently-called jQuery event handler was attached. Bind an event handler to the “keydown” event, or trigger that event on an element. This is the full list of Ajax events, and in the order in which they are triggered. Mar 26, 2010 · Tom G above created function that filters document for only events of given element and merges output of both methods, but it had a flaw of duplicating events in the output (and effectively on the element's jQuery internal event list messing with your application). trigger() do not use this list, since the code can construct a jQuery. 22. data(elem, 'events') you can now use jQuery. The jQuery UI Menu widget creates a menu list that is used for mouse and keyboard interactions. 8, removed in 1. Apr 23, 2024 · Direct events are only attached to elements at the time the . Custom Events. jQuery Event Methods. com/category/events/ But regarding the paste event you mentioned, jQuery can also bind to standard DOM events. which also normalizes button presses (mousedown and mouseupevents), reporting 1 for left button, 2 for middle, and 3 for right. Here we discuss the list of the most common and frequently used various events of jQuery with syntax and examples. which property normalizes event. 7+ you can attach an event handler to a parent element using . jQuery keypress() May 31, 2022 · jQueryには20以上のイベントがあるため、全てを理解したり用途に合わせて使い分けるのが難しいです。この記事ではjQueryのイベントを一覧で紹介し、サンプルコードを用いて使い方を紹介します。 最後まで記事を読むと、jQueryのイベント一覧を理解し、用途に合わせて適切なイベントを使用 Bind an event handler to the “load” event, or trigger that event on an element. on() method with the dt namespace (all events are triggered with the dt namespace to ensure they do not conflict with custom events from other libraries!). This is called an event binding. Feb 3, 2017 · jQuery event when specific option is selected with Ajax HTML structure Hot Network Questions What will happen if i select the Erase disk and install Ubuntu option in VMware? jQuery 事件處理 (Events) jQuery 的事件處理函式大都提供兩種用途,一種是呼叫帶有參數的函式 - 綁定事件處理函式;另一種則是呼叫不帶有參數的函式 - 觸發該事件。 Jun 4, 2021 · The jQuery AJAX Events are called whenever there is an AJAX call in the web page. The jQuery blur () is an inbuilt method that is used to remove focus from the selected element. jQuery in Action Bear Bibeault, Yehuda Katz, and Aurelio De Rosa; For a complete list of those events, see the events category. For select boxes, checkboxes, and radio buttons, the event is fired immediately when the user makes a selection with the mouse, but for the other element types the event is deferred until the element loses focus. type to determine whether the event is mouseenter or mouseleave. See Also. which instead Jan 24, 2013 · UPDATE (8/24/2012): While the function above still works in jQuery 1. Three API methods are used to interact with the events triggered by Editor: on() - Listen for events; one() - Listen for a single event JavaScript/jQuery TextBox Events This section describes events fired by this UI component. on() to respond to any event on the selected elements. Event listener for few elements at once. What are Events? All the different visitors' actions that a web page can respond to are called events. _data($('yourelement')[0], "events"); This gives a nested list of all the bound events, grouped by the "base" event (no namespace). Jquery Multiple elements-Multiple events Aug 18, 2012 · I want to load all events on FullCalendar using AJAX when I clicked next-previous-button in agenda-views. the window. php' then it will return event{ id: ,title: , start: , end: , allDay: } format data for rendering on calendar. link Event Propagation. . on() method provides several useful Events. org/en-US/docs/Web/Events Oct 16, 2023 · The Complete List of jQuery events are listed below: jQuery Mouse events. event, which has some of them under $. a. If your goal is just to do this as part of debugging, Chrome itself can show you the event listeners attached to an element at the DOM level, see this question and its answers, and there are Chrome extensions (like this one) that can show you the jQuery event handlers as well (since jQuery maintains its own list of handlers, using only a single handler Here's the list of some jQuery events: S. eodpgciaojbucamiokaadeqaapirflcvfsmgwronziabemrvduzwlqlentpbencmbcmjrcecbryea